Kirkland Lake Gold Ltd. ("Kirkland Lake Gold" or the "Company") (TSX:KL) (NYSE:KL) (ASX:KLA) today reported new drill results from underground exploration drilling at the Macassa Mine in Kirkland Lake, Ontario. The new results include 71 drill holes (29,207 m) of drilling from the east and west exploration drifts on the 5300-foot level ("5300 Level") as well as from the 5600 Level Ramp Development ("5600 Ramp"). Results being reported today are from four underground drill rigs focused on three key target areas, the SMC East, SMC West and the Amalgamated Break. Drilling from the 5300 Level and 5600 Ramp will continue throughout the remainder of 2019, with an additional two drill rigs having recently been added to the exploration program.

A total of 41 drill holes for 18,943 m drilled to the east of the SMC from the 5300 Level east exploration drift intersected high-grade mineralization approximately 200 m northeast of the existing Mineral Resource (Figure 2). A total of 16 drill holes for 6,401 m of drilling were completed from the 5300 Level west exploration drift targeting zones west of the SMC as well as in the Lower SMC. Results from this drilling include high-grade intersections up to 275 m west of existing Mineral Resources (see Figure 2) and 25 m further west of high-grade intersections reported in the Company's news release dated May 2, 2019. An additional 14 drill holes for 3,863 m of drilling were completed from the 5300 Level west exploration drift and the 5600 Ramp targeting the Amalgamated Break and associated hanging wall mineralization (Figure 3). This drilling resulted in new high-grade intersections up to 175 m west of existing SMC Mineral Resources and within previously identified high-pote ntial target areas along the Amalgamated Break (see news release dated May 2, 2019 for more information).

SMC East

A total of 41 drill holes for 18,943 m of drilling has recently been completed from the 5300 Level east exploration drift targeting the SMC East (Figure 2). The SMC East comprises a shallow dipping (~30 degrees) mineralized horizon including localized high-grade gold bearing quartz veins and/or structural features. Exploration drilling intersected high-grade gold mineralization approximately 200 m northeast of the current resource area, further supporting the potential for resource growth. Key intersections from the new drill results include: 111.8 g/t over 2.1 m true width in Hole 53-3790 (SMC East), 53.0 g/t over 2.1 m true width in Hole 53-3853 (SMC East), 49.2 g/t over 2.0 m core length in Hole 53-3818 (Footwall Zone, true width unknown). Refer to Table 1 for a complete list of drill hole results. Diamond drilling from this current drill platform has been ongoing since Q1 2019 and will continue through the end of the year. Exploration development will be ongoing to the ea st on 5300 Level for the remainder of 2019 and will continue into 2020 to support further exploration efforts on the SMC East and other targets.

SMC West

A total of 16 drill holes for 6,401 m of drilling has recently been completed from the 5300 Level west exploration drift targeting the SMC West (Figure 3). Results from this drilling include high-grade intersections up to 275 m west of existing Mineral Resources and 25 m further west of high-grade intersections reported in the Company's news release dated May 2, 2019. The SMC West comprises shallow and steep dipping mineralized zones including localized high-grade gold bearing quartz veins and/or structural features. As drilling continues to extend the mineralized area further west and away from the current Mineral Resource, follow up infill drilling will be required to confirm the geometry of individual zones. As such, true widths have not yet been calculated for assay composites during this phase of the drill program. Drill holes of note in this area include: 46.5 g/t over 2.0 m core length in Hole 53-3784 (true width unknown), 24.4 g/t over 2.0 m core length in Hole 53-37 81 (true width unknown) and 17.7 g/t over 2.2 m core length in Hole 53-3752 (true width unknown). Refer to Table 2 for a completed list of drill hole results. Exploration development during the first half of 2019, as well as the excavation of a diamond drill bay an additional 165 m west of the current platform in early Q3, will allow for additional exploration drilling on SMC West targets during the second half of the year.

Amalgamated Break and Hanging Wall

A total of 14 holes for 3,863 m of drilling is being reported from drilling off of the 5300 Level west exploration drift and the 5600 Ramp targeting the Amalgamated Break and South SMC (Figure 3). This early-stage drilling program is focused on mineralization associated with the steeply dipping Amalgamated Break deformation zone. The current phase of the exploration drilling program has been successful in intersecting additional high-grade mineralization within the deformation zone, as well as in localized zones outside of the main deformation zone. Drill holes of note in this area include: 108.2 g/t over 3.3 m core length in Hole 56-735A (true width unknown), 51.3 g/t over 2.0 m core length in Hole 56-749 (true width unknown) and 20.1 g/t over 5.4 m core length in Hole 53-3839 (true width unknown). The shallow dipping SMC is bounded to the south by the Amalgamated Break and the area drilled during this phase occurs where the shallow dipping SMC transitions into the Amalgam ated Break. Further drilling and interpretation work are necessary to confirm geometries of individual intercepts. Refer to Table 2 for a completed list of drill hole results. The Amalgamated Break has been largely untested and represents an important emerging exploration target which remains open and represents a highly prospective target area for the addition of new Mineral Resource ounces. Drilling to follow up on the down dip and eastern and western extent of this mineralization will continue throughout 2019.

2019 Underground Exploration Development

Underground development on the 5300 Level will be ongoing throughout 2019 and is scheduled to include 350 m of advancement to the east and 429 m of advancement to the west, including all track development and the excavation of diamond drill bays. This development is part of an ongoing effort to expand the SMC in all directions and to test for, and define, new target areas.

Two more drills have recently been added to the underground exploration program at Macassa to expedite the current drilling program and test additional areas of the SMC and Amalgamated Break. It is anticipated that exploration drilling will continue with six underground diamond drills for the remainder of the year.

QA/QC Controls

The Company has implemented a quality assurance and control ("QA/QC") program to ensure sampling and analysis of all exploration work is conducted in accordance with best practices. The drill core is sawn in half with one half of the core samples shipped to Swastika Laboratories in Swastika, Ontario. The other half of the core is retained for future assay verification. Other QA/QC includes the insertion of certified reference standards, blanks and the regular re-assaying of pulps and rejects at alternate certified labs. Gold analysis is conducted by fire assay using atomic absorption or gravimetric finish. The laboratory re-assays at least 10% of all samples and additional checks may be run on anomalous values.

Cautionary Note to U.S. Investors - Mineral Reserve and Resource Estimates

All resource and reserve estimates included in this news release or documents referenced in this news release have been prepared in accordance with Canadian National Instrument 43-101 - Standards of Disclosure for Mineral Projects ("NI 43-101") and the Canadian Institute of Mining, Metallurgy and Petroleum (the "CIM") - CIM Definition Standards on Mineral Resources and Mineral Reserves, adopted by the CIM Council, as amended (the "CIM Standards"). NI 43-101 is a rule developed by the Canadian Securities Administrators, which established standards for all public disclosure an issuer makes of scientific and technical information concerning mineral projects. The terms "mineral reserve", "proven mineral reserve" and "probable mineral reserve" are Canadian mining terms as defined in accordance with NI 43-101 and the CIM Standards. These definitions differ materially from the definitions in SEC Industry Guide 7 ("SEC Industry Guide 7") under the United States Securities Act of 1933, as amended, and the Exchange Act.

In addition, the terms "Mineral Resource", "measured Mineral Resource", "indicated Mineral Resource" and "Inferred Mineral Resource" are defined in and required to be disclosed by NI 43-101 and the CIM Standards; however, these terms are not defined terms under SEC Industry Guide 7 and are normally not permitted to be used in reports and registration statements filed with the U.S. Securities and Exchange Commission (the "SEC"). Investors are cautioned not to assume that all or any part of mineral deposits in these categories will ever be converted into reserves. "Inferred Mineral Resources" have a great amount of uncertainty as to their existence, and great uncertainty as to their economic and legal feasibility. It cannot be assumed that all or any part of an Inferred Mineral Resource will ever be upgraded to a higher category. Under Canadian rules, estimates of Inferred Mineral Resources may not form the basis of feasibility or pre-feasibility studies, except in very limited circumstances. Investors are cautioned not to assume that all or any part of a Mineral Resource exists, will ever be converted into a Mineral Reserve or is or will ever be economically or legally mineable or recovered.
